如何在跨平台应用中使用AI语音SDK

随着科技的不断发展,人工智能(AI)技术已经渗透到了我们生活的方方面面。其中,AI语音技术以其便捷、高效的特点,受到了广大开发者和用户的喜爱。跨平台应用开发中,如何使用AI语音SDK,实现语音识别、语音合成等功能,成为了许多开发者关注的焦点。本文将讲述一位开发者在使用AI语音SDK过程中的故事,希望能为读者提供一些借鉴和启示。

故事的主人公是一位名叫小王的年轻程序员。小王所在的公司是一家初创企业,主要从事移动应用开发。在一次偶然的机会,小王接触到了AI语音技术,并对其产生了浓厚的兴趣。他认为,将AI语音技术应用到自己的产品中,将为用户带来全新的体验。

然而,面对市面上众多的AI语音SDK,小王陷入了纠结。他不知道如何选择合适的SDK,也不知道如何将其应用到自己的产品中。在经过一番调研和比较后,小王决定尝试使用某知名AI语音公司的SDK。

为了更好地了解SDK的使用方法,小王查阅了大量的资料,并参加了该公司举办的线上培训课程。在掌握了SDK的基本使用方法后,他开始着手将语音识别和语音合成功能应用到自己的产品中。

在开发过程中,小王遇到了许多困难。首先,他发现SDK的文档不够详细,很多功能的使用方法需要自己摸索。其次,由于跨平台开发,小王需要针对不同平台进行适配,这让他倍感压力。此外,在调试过程中,小王还遇到了一些意想不到的问题,如语音识别准确率不高、语音合成音质不佳等。

面对这些困难,小王没有放弃。他开始从以下几个方面着手解决问题:

  1. 深入研究SDK文档,寻找解决问题的线索。在遇到问题时,小王会仔细阅读SDK文档,查找相关功能的使用方法和注意事项。同时,他还关注了社区论坛,与其他开发者交流心得,共同解决难题。

  2. 针对不同平台进行适配。小王了解到,不同平台对SDK的依赖程度不同,因此他需要针对不同平台进行适配。在开发过程中,他不断调整代码,确保产品在各个平台上都能正常运行。

  3. 优化语音识别和语音合成功能。为了提高语音识别准确率和语音合成音质,小王尝试了多种方法。例如,他调整了语音识别的参数,优化了语音合成模型,并引入了降噪技术。

经过一段时间的努力,小王终于将AI语音功能成功地应用到自己的产品中。产品上线后,用户反响热烈,纷纷表示语音识别和语音合成功能给他们的生活带来了便利。

然而,小王并没有满足于此。他意识到,AI语音技术还有很大的发展空间,自己还有很多需要学习和提高的地方。于是,他开始关注行业动态,学习最新的AI语音技术,并尝试将这些技术应用到自己的产品中。

在后续的开发过程中,小王成功地将语音翻译、语音唤醒等功能引入到产品中。这些新功能的加入,使得产品更加完善,用户体验也得到了进一步提升。

通过这次跨平台应用中使用AI语音SDK的经历,小王收获颇丰。他不仅学会了如何使用AI语音技术,还积累了宝贵的开发经验。以下是他在使用AI语音SDK过程中总结的一些经验:

  1. 选择合适的AI语音SDK。在众多AI语音SDK中,选择适合自己的SDK至关重要。要综合考虑SDK的功能、性能、易用性等因素。

  2. 深入研究SDK文档。SDK文档是了解和使用SDK的重要依据,要充分利用文档资源,提高开发效率。

  3. 针对不同平台进行适配。跨平台开发需要针对不同平台进行适配,确保产品在各个平台上都能正常运行。

  4. 不断优化功能。在开发过程中,要关注用户体验,不断优化语音识别、语音合成等功能,提高产品竞争力。

  5. 关注行业动态。AI语音技术发展迅速,要关注行业动态,学习最新的技术,为产品创新提供源源不断的动力。

总之,跨平台应用中使用AI语音SDK,需要开发者具备一定的技术能力和耐心。通过不断学习和实践,相信每位开发者都能在AI语音领域取得丰硕的成果。

猜你喜欢:AI助手开发